Role Description

As a Senior Travel Advisor, you will lead a team of Travel Advisors while managing high-touch client relationships and overseeing the execution of complex luxury travel arrangements. This role requires exceptional client relations paired with meticulous execution of detailed travel planning — deep industry expertise, strategic problem-solving, and strong leadership skills — acting as a mentor, problem-solver, and trusted resource for both clients and team members. Please note that this is not an entry-level role and significant previous travel advisor experience is required.

Requirements

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• **Team Thinking **: Spearhead your team’s research on destinations, activities, dining experiences, etc.
  • **Execution & Planning **: Handle execution of all trip booking details from hotels to transfers to reservations and more and build detailed and comprehensive travel itineraries
  • **Maintaining Relationships **: Work directly with hotels, villa suppliers, DMCs and local fixers globally
  • Passion for Travel: Tap your love for travel; provide targeted travel intelligence and advice tailored to each specific member's needs
  • **Proactivity & Creativity **: Seek out solutions off the books when needed
  • **Team Leadership & Mentorship **: Guide and mentor Travel Advisors, ensuring excellence in execution and service
  • Member Relationship Managem ent: Maintain and deepen relationships with an exceptional group of high-end travelers as your clients, acting as their trusted travel expert
  • **Crisis Management & Problem Solving **: Step in for high-stakes situations, handling escalations and resolving emergencies with confidence
  • **Strategic Oversight **: Seamlessly integrate into any trip planning scenario, providing expertise across teams when needed
  • **Process & Service Enhancement **: Contribute to Marchay’s ongoing evolution by optimizing service offerings and internal processes

REQUIREMENTS:

  • **Location **: While this role is remote, you are based in North America and are willing to work Eastern Time Zone hours
  • Education: Bachelor's degree is required
  • **Industry Leader **: Minimum 4+ years in luxury travel planning, with experience managing clients and teams
  • **Highly Strategic **: Capable of handling 50-60 trips at once, prioritizing efficiently while maintaining quality
  • **Tech Savvy **: Experience with industry tools, such as Sabre GDS, Axus for itinerary-building, and Salesforce as a CRM
  • **Product Knowledge **: You have excellent taste and deep industry knowledge. You understand the nuances (e.g., the difference between the Connaught and the Berkeley in London)
  • **Mentor & Coach **: Adept at guiding Travel Advisors, fostering their growth and independence
  • **Problem-Solver **: Comfortable navigating complex, high-pressure scenarios and handling escalations with ease
  • **Resourceful & Proactive **: Able to quickly adapt to changes, step into new trip planning scenarios, and provide seamless support
